Страница 1 из 1

Табель рабочего времени

Добавлено: 21 мар 2007, 13:25
lerich
Такая вот задача: нужно определить, количество отработанных часов сотрудником за месяц, все его неявки. А также такую же информацию по подразделениям (и категориям) за месяц.
Вроде бы эта информация хранится в таблице LSTAB, но у меня ерунда какая-то выходит.
Можете подсказать, где отображается эта информация... :-?

Добавлено: 21 мар 2007, 15:02
edward_K
то поле что с часами - если там больше 20, то это либо отпуск, либо больничный - наверное у вас с этим проблема.
а так журнал смотрите - мож что еще что заметите, например итоговые часы могут (в зависимости от настроек) падать во внешние атрибуты.

Добавлено: 21 мар 2007, 17:10
lerich
а как определить Фонд Времени за месяц - это сколько часов по календарю за месяц (у нас график 40 часовой недели, 5 дней в неделю рабочих) - для февраля это 175,2; для марта уже другое значение. В какой таблице находится это значение?

Добавлено: 21 мар 2007, 17:36
edward_K
klndr с фильтром по нужному режиму, месяцу и году.
либо wt_GHBD ( описание найдете в "функциях для использования алгоритма" - если не знаете где это, то забудьте) - как ее использовать уже обсуждалось.

Добавлено: 23 мар 2007, 11:53
lerich
спасибо, нашла в klndr нужную информацию.
мне ard-отчет надо написать, поэтому информацию надо вытаскивать через таблицы, запросы.
Думала, что в klndr для указанного года и месяца будет уже указано суммарное количество рабочих дней, часов - ошиблась, там по каждому дню ;(
А в ЗП, я знаю, где эта функция wt_GHBD, только вот пока не знаю, как мне до нее добраться, чтобы в отчете использовать

Добавлено: 23 мар 2007, 16:55
edward_K
на форму это уже обсуждалось
поищите InitWorkingTable